JENKINS Mrs. Shirley Davis Jenkins, 67, of Winston-Salem passed away on Wednesday, June 4, 2008, at Wake Forest University Baptist Medical Center. She was born in Mecklenburg County, Pineville, on Jan. 6, 1941, to James Ross Davis and Gladys Freeman Davis of Rockingham. She lived in Rockingham...
